Common Name -  White Campion
Scientific Name - Lychnis alba
Family Name -  Pink (Caryophyllaceae)

 Season
Annual, blooms throughout the summer and into the fall.

 Habitat
Waste places, roadsides, dry fields.

 Flower
Regular,white or pinkish with 5 notched petals. Sepals are fused to from a "bladder" behind the flower head. Flower diameter is approximately 1 inch.

 Leaves
Simple, lance shaped, without lobes or teeth, opposite arrangement along the stem. Some upper leaves and stems have a downy appearance.
